#demon-details{flex-direction:column;align-items:center;gap:.5vh;width:30%;display:flex}#demon-details .detail{justify-content:space-between;width:90%;font-size:85%;display:flex}#demon-details .detail .title{text-align:left;max-width:50%;font-weight:700;overflow:hidden}#demon-details .detail .title.long{max-width:70%}#demon-details .detail .value{text-align:right;max-width:60%;overflow:hidden}#demon-details .hidden .value{font-style:italic}#demon-details #lore{width:90%;font-size:80%}#middle{width:40%}#demon-image{--guess1:500%;--guess2:400%;--guess3:300%;--guess4:200%;--guess5:150%;aspect-ratio:1;background-color:#fff;justify-content:center;align-items:center;width:100%;height:50vh;margin-bottom:1vh;display:flex;overflow:hidden}#demon-image img{object-fit:contain;pointer-events:none;width:1000vw;height:1000vh}#demon-image img.guess1{height:var(--guess1);max-width:var(--guess1);align-self:flex-start}#demon-image img.guess2{height:var(--guess2);max-width:var(--guess2);align-self:flex-end}#demon-image img.guess3{height:var(--guess3);max-width:var(--guess3);align-self:center}#demon-image img.guess4{height:var(--guess4);max-width:var(--guess4);align-self:flex-start}#demon-image img.guess5{height:var(--guess5);max-width:var(--guess5);align-self:flex-end}#demon-image img.guess6{max-width:100%;height:100%}#demon-image img.unsolved{filter:brightness(0)}#demon-skills{width:30%}#skills{flex-direction:column;justify-content:center;align-items:center;gap:1vh;margin-top:1vh;display:flex}#skills .skill{width:90%;height:5vh;overflow:none;background-color:#444;border-radius:2.5vh;outline:.1vw solid #fff;align-items:center;gap:.4vw;display:flex}#skills .skill img{max-height:80%;margin-left:1.5%}#guesses{flex-direction:column;justify-content:center;gap:1vh;width:100%;display:flex}#guesses .guess{background-color:#3d0000;border-radius:.5vw;outline:.1vw solid red}#guesses .guess.solved{background-color:#006400;outline-color:#adff2f}#demon-name{color:orange;font-family:Franklin Gothic Medium,Arial Narrow,Arial,sans-serif;font-size:4ch;font-weight:700;line-height:1}#demon-name.correct{color:#adff2f}#select-demon option{background-color:#000}#guess-input{background-color:#000;border-radius:.5vw;justify-content:space-between;width:100%;padding:.1vw;display:flex;position:relative}#guess-input #select-demon{border-radius:.5vw;outline:.1vw solid #fff;width:75%}#guess-input .inner-select{background-color:#000;border:none;border-radius:.5vw;width:100%}#guess-input .input,#guess-input .value,#guess-input .new-input{color:#fff}#guess-input button{border-radius:.5vw;outline:.1vw solid #fff;width:20%;padding:0 .5vw;overflow:hidden}#guess-input button:hover{color:#fff;background-color:red}#guess-input .option{color:#fff;background-color:#000;border-radius:.5vw}#guess-input .option:hover{color:#000;background-color:#fff}#guess-input .menu-list{background-color:#000;border:.1vw solid #fff}#guess-input .separator{background-color:#000}#twitter img{filter:brightness(1000%)}#feedback img{filter:invert()}#press-turns{justify-content:right;width:20%;display:flex;position:fixed;top:5%;right:0%}#press-turns img{width:30%}#press-turns .flashing{animation:1s infinite blink}#share{cursor:pointer}#share img{filter:invert()}#share:disabled{cursor:not-allowed}#share:disabled img{filter:invert()brightness(20%)}#restart-mandala img{filter:invert()}#next-mandala:disabled{cursor:not-allowed}#next-mandala:disabled img{filter:brightness(20%)}@media (width<=960px){#demon-name{font-size:3ch}#demon-details,#middle,#demon-skills{width:90%}#demon-details{order:2;font-size:85%}#demon-details .detail,#demon-details #lore{width:90%}#middle{order:1}#demon-skills{order:3}#demon-skills #skills .skill{gap:1vw;width:90%;font-size:80%}#guess-input{font-size:50%}}#demondle{color:#fff}#background{object-fit:cover;opacity:.3;height:130%;position:fixed;top:-20%;left:0}#title{text-align:center;width:20%;font-family:p5hatty,Trebuchet MS,Lucida Sans Unicode,Lucida Grande,Lucida Sans,Arial,sans-serif;font-size:5ch;line-height:1;position:absolute;top:5%}#nav{text-align:center;flex-direction:column;gap:3vh;width:16%;display:flex;position:absolute;top:15%;left:2%}#nav .nav-button{outline:.51vw solid #000;font-size:4ch}#nav .nav-button.disabled{color:#292929;cursor:not-allowed;outline-color:#292929}#nav .nav-button.disabled:hover{background-color:gray}.nav-button{color:#000;background-color:gray;border-radius:.5vw;justify-content:center;align-items:center;font-family:p5hatty,Trebuchet MS,Lucida Sans Unicode,Lucida Grande,Lucida Sans,Arial,sans-serif;display:flex}.nav-button.selected{color:#fff;pointer-events:none;background-color:red}.nav-button:hover{color:#000;background-color:#fff}#game{text-align:center;background-color:#000000f2;border-radius:.5vw;outline:.1vw solid red;width:60%;height:88%;position:absolute;top:5%;left:20vw;overflow-y:hidden}#game h1{font-family:p5hatty,Trebuchet MS,Lucida Sans Unicode,Lucida Grande,Lucida Sans,Arial,sans-serif;font-size:3ch}.columns{flex-direction:row;justify-content:center;display:flex}#page-title{font-family:p5hatty,Trebuchet MS,Lucida Sans Unicode,Lucida Grande,Lucida Sans,Arial,sans-serif;font-size:4ch}@keyframes blink{0%,to{opacity:1}50%{opacity:0}}#footer{--footer-height:5vh;height:var(--footer-height);white-space:nowrap;text-align:center;justify-content:space-between;align-items:flex-end;width:100%;display:flex;position:fixed;bottom:1%;left:0}#footer img{cursor:pointer;height:var(--footer-height);width:var(--footer-height)}#footer #mandala-toggle{color:#fff;background-color:red;outline:.1vw solid #fff;width:60%;height:100%;padding-top:.5vh;font-size:3ch;line-height:.5}#footer #mandala-toggle:hover{color:#000;background-color:#fff}.bottom-container{justify-content:space-evenly;gap:2vw;width:10%;margin:0 1vw;display:flex}.bottom-container.left{justify-content:left}.bottom-container.right{justify-content:right}#info img{filter:invert()}@keyframes fade-in{0%{opacity:0}to{opacity:1}}.modal{text-align:center;background-color:#000;border-radius:1vw;outline:.2vw solid #adff2f;flex-direction:column;justify-content:center;align-items:center;gap:10vh;width:50%;height:80%;padding:1.5vw;font-size:4.5ch;animation:.5s forwards fade-in;display:flex;position:fixed;top:10%;left:25%;overflow:auto}.modal .modal-buttons{justify-content:space-evenly;gap:1vw;width:80%;display:flex}.modal .modal-buttons button{border-radius:1vw;outline:.1vw solid #adff2f;width:50%;padding:1vw;display:block}.modal button:hover{color:#000;background-color:#adff2f}.modal button:active{background-color:green}.modal.failed{outline-color:red}.modal.failed .modal-buttons button{outline-color:red}.modal.failed button:hover{background-color:red}.modal.failed button:active{background-color:#8b0000}.modal .close-text{font-size:75%}.info-modal{gap:3.5vh;font-size:1.9ch}.info-modal h1{margin-bottom:-3vh;font-family:p5hatty,Trebuchet MS,Lucida Sans Unicode,Lucida Grande,Lucida Sans,Arial,sans-serif;font-size:200%;line-height:1}.info-modal hr{background-color:#fff;width:100%;height:.1vh;padding:0}@media (width<=960px){#back-arrow.demondle{height:3%}#title{width:100vw;font-size:4ch;top:.5%;left:0}#page-title{font-size:3ch}#press-turns{display:none}#nav{flex-direction:row;justify-content:space-between;gap:3vw;width:90%;height:5%;position:absolute;top:6%;left:5%}#nav .nav-button{width:50%;height:100%;font-size:3ch;display:flex}#game{width:90%;height:82%;padding-bottom:2vh;font-size:2.25ch;top:12%;left:5%;overflow-y:auto}.columns{flex-direction:column;align-items:center;gap:5vh}#footer{--footer-height:4vh;bottom:.5%}.bottom-container{width:15%}.bottom-container a{max-width:50%}.bottom-container img{aspect-ratio:1;max-width:100%}.modal{gap:5vh;width:85%;height:80%;padding:3vh 0;font-size:3ch;top:10%;left:7.5%}.modal .modal-buttons{flex-direction:column;gap:2vh}.modal .modal-buttons button{width:100%;padding:3vw}.info-modal{gap:3vh;font-size:1.7ch}.info-modal h1{font-size:3ch}}
